A flywheel of mass 189 kg has an effective radius of 0.61 m (assume the mass is concentrated along a circumference located at the effective radius of the flywheel).
(a) How much work is done to bring this wheel from rest to a speed of 120 rpm in a time interval of 29.8 s?
kJ
(b) What is the applied torque on the flywheel (assumed constant)?
N · m
